Everex Stepnote VA4101M, priced at $498, is the first available sub-$500 notebook with Windows Vista operating system.
The 15.4-inch widescreen Stepnote VA4101M comes with Windows Vista Home Basic Edition preinstalled and it’s powered by Intel Celeron M Processor at 1.46GHz. It has 512MB of DDR2 533 SDRAM memory, which is upgradeable to up to 2GB. Everex Stepnote VA4101M incorporates VIA Chrome9 HC integrated graphics which powers the screen with 1280 x 800 maximal resolution and shares up to 128MB of system memory. It ships with 60GB hard drive and a DVD burner.
The VA4101M provides 802.11b/g wireless connection, Ethernet LAN and a built-In 56k modem, and features three USB ports and a VGA out.
The notebook weights 5.9lbs. There is no info on battery life.
The Everex Stepnote VA4101M with Windows Vista Basic is available for purchase at Wal-Mart.
